  • Title

    Vertical Spot Size Converter with 0.06dB/facet coupling loss using 2.5%Δ silica-based waveguide

  • Abstract
    A vertical spot size converter (SSC) with vertically tapered structure was made by using plasma enhanced chemical vapor deposition (PECVD) and a shadow mask. With the vertical SSC, a coupling loss between 2.5%Delta waveguide and a single mode fiber (SMF) was decreased to 0.06 dB/facet, drastically.
